For example, you can easily swap your current LIDAR with an other model without break your setup, because each LIDAR publish the same LaserScan message. LiDAR, or Light Detection and Ranging, It can also be found by another name, LADAR (Laser Detection and Ranging) an active remote sensing technology that measures distance using light in the form of a pulsed laser.
